Spice Hut is a takeaway/sandwich shop located at 1264 London Road, Derby, DE24 8QP, in the Derby City local authority area. Following its most recent inspection on 25 March 2026, it received a food hygiene rating of 2 (Improvement Necessary). The inspection assessed three categories: hygienic food handling (scored 15 — generally satisfactory), structural compliance (scored 5 — very good), and confidence in management (scored 10 — good). In the FHRS scoring system, lower numbers indicate better performance, with 0 being the best possible score in each category. Derby City oversees 2,295 registered food businesses, of which 77% hold a rating of Good (4) or Very Good (5). The average food hygiene rating in Derby City is 4.5 out of 5. As a takeaway or sandwich shop, this business is assessed on food preparation practices, packaging hygiene, temperature control during storage and delivery, and the cleanliness of preparation areas. Food businesses in the UK are inspected by local authority environmental health officers. The frequency of inspections depends on the risk category — higher-risk businesses are inspected more frequently, typically every 6 to 12 months, while lower-risk establishments may be inspected every 2 to 3 years. The rating has changed from 3 to 2 since 11 September 2024. Businesses that are not satisfied with their rating can request a re-inspection from their local authority or apply for a right to reply, which is published alongside the rating on the FSA website.
